  1. Improvements and residence on the land comprised in the lease shall be as provided in Part III of the said Act. The provisions of section 162, and all other provisions of the said Act with respect to substantial improvements, shall apply accordingly to lessees under these regulations. The provisions of section 159, and all other provisions of the said Act in respect of compulsory residence, shall apply accordingly to lessees under these regulations.

  2. No lessee shall divide, sublet, or transfer the land held by him under these regulations, except under and subject to the provisions of Part I of the said Act.

  3. No lessee shall apply for or hold more than one allotment, and such allotment shall be held for his or her sole use and benefit, and not for the use or benefit of any other person whomsoever.

  4. All the provisions of the said Act, so far as applicable, shall extend and apply to the lands affected by these regulations, and to the applications and leases to be made and issued thereunder, and generally to the interests created, and the persons whose rights, liabilities, or interests are thereby affected; and the mention of any particular provision of the said Act shall not be deemed to exclude any other provision of the said Act applicable to the particular case.

Lands in Hawke’s Bay Land District open for Sale or Selection.


District Lands Office,
Napier, 20th December, 1909.

NOTICE is hereby given that the undermentioned lands are open for sale or selection, and applications will be received at this office, and at the Drill Hall, Dannevirke, on Monday, the 21st day of February, 1910, up to 4 o’clock p.m., under the provisions of “The Land Act, 1908.”


SCHEDULE.

HAWKE’S BAY LAND DISTRICT.

FIRST-CLASS LAND.

Dannevirke County.—Norsewood Survey District.

A. R. P. £ s. d. £ s. d. £ s. d.
2 | XV | 100 0 0 | 950 0 0 | 23 15 0 | 19 0 0
Distant about seven miles and a half from Dannevirke by good metalled dray-road, in what is locally known as the “Rokai Settlement.” The section comprises flat and undulating agricultural land, covered with mixed bush, with a thick undergrowth of wineberry and weeds. The forest has been milled, and a fire passed through it. The forest consists of a number of dead standing trees of tawa, rimu, rata, &c. The soil is of good quality, being a clay formation on gravel. Well watered by the Rokai Whana Stream. Elevation ranges from 950 ft. to 1,000 ft. above sea-level.

GENERAL DESCRIPTION.

Kumeti Block is portion of Tamaki Block, and is situated seven miles and three-quarters from Dannevirke, and five miles from Tahoraite Railway-siding. For some years dairying has been successfully carried on in the locality, and a dairy factory is in operation about half a mile from the junction of the Kumeti and Otamaraho Roads. A school was recently opened on the Kumeti Road, about one mile and a quarter from the same junction. The block consists of mixed forest country, varying in altitude from 830 ft. to 2,250 ft. above sea-level; the bush being principally mahoe, tawa, rimu, tawhero, towai, with dense undergrowth of fern and supplejacks. Most of the land is flat, and will be ploughable when cleared and stumped. The soil on the hills is light, but the flats comprise rich alluvial deposit overlying shingle.
